Arsenal has managed to mark a great victory with a overthrow on the journey to Aston Willlas with a score of 2:4.
Watkins moved the locals to the upper fifth minute of the match.
However, Saka equalled the figures at 16.
The locals managed to restore the advantage in the 31st minute, after a super action that concreteised Coutinho goal.
“The Topchis” found strength to match the score once again, when Zinchenko scored a fine goal in the 61st minute.
In the second extra minute, a Jorginho bomb forced goalkeeper Emiliano Martinez to score autogogues.
In the last few seconds, however, Martinell scored the easiest career goal with the empty gate.
With this victory, Arsenal goes to 54 points in first place, three more than Manchester City.
On the other hand, Aston Villa remains in 11th place with 28 points collected.
